Sweepstakes casinos are the main attraction in the US. These platforms, exclusively available under US federal laws, support two virtual currencies, usually sweeps coins (SC) and gold coins (GC).
GC can be bought for money, and SC are offered in return for free. Both currencies are featured in promotional campaigns at sweepstake casinos. Any SCs that are played through can be redeemed for the equivalent amount in USD. Sounds great, right?

Social casinos are nothing new. We decided to cover them here since they are often presented as identical to sweepstake casinos. Instead, these sites provide a relatively larger selection of slots, often powered by iGaming studios that produce games from real money online casinos. Like sweepstake casinos, they are available in almost every US state – but also worldwide. Their difference? They support a single virtual currency, with no option for redeeming cash prizes.

A few platforms settle for a middle road, where they support two virtual currencies. The one is similar to gold coins, without any real money value. The second one, often branded around the casino theme, is redeemable for gift cards or rewards at partnered brick-and-mortar casinos.

Skillz.com and PCH Games are the parent companies of numerous Android and iOS gaming apps. Each app consists of a single game, like Bingo Blitz or Pool PayDay, and allows users to compete for points.
No purchase is necessary to play on these, and getting real money rewards can be challenging. It is still possible through leaderboards or in the form of gift and prepaid cards. However, most of the games supported by these social platforms are based on skill, so you might need to practice first.

Are sweepstake casinos legal?
Sweepstake casinos are legal in 47 US states, excluding Michigan, Washington and Idaho. Players over 18 can sign-up and play free slots and games there.

Can I play sweepstakes games for free?
Sweepstake casinos do not require users to make a purchase to enter the games. That’s a rule they must abide by to be legal in the states. They stick to it by offering users sign-up coins and free daily bonuses.
